Water Shut Down and Boil Water Advisory in Core Area

Water Shut Down and Boil Water Advisory in Core Area

Please be advised of a water shut down in the Core Area on Tuesday, December 8, 2020 from approximately 1 p.m. to 5 p.m. to allow for a repair to the water infrastructure.

Location of water interruption: 782,784,786,788,790,792,806,808,810.

The City of Iqaluit is issuing a boil water advisory for these residents.

This is a precautionary measure due to a break in the water line during a repair to our water infrastructure.

Iqaluit Fire Department Responds to House Fire in Happy Valley

Iqaluit Fire Department Responds to House Fire in Happy Valley

 

At 09:56 on December 7, 2020, Iqaluit Emergency Services were called to the Happy Valley area of Iqaluit for reports of a house on fire. The Iqaluit fire crew consisting of fourteen (14) members and seven (7) emergency service vehicles responded to scene.

On arrival, firefighters found flames already exiting a window, made quick entry into the house, and were able to keep the fire contained to the room of origin.

Snowmobile Safety and Reminders

Snowmobile Safety and Reminders

 

The City would like to remind snowmobilers to use caution and follow safe driving practices
when operating a snowmobile this winter.

As per City By-Law 557, snowmobilers are required to be considerate and respectful of other
residents and private property. Please only use snowmobile trails that are clearly marked, as
outlined on the attached snowmobile trail map.

COVID-19 and City of Iqaluit Update

Public Service Announcement

COVID-19 and City of Iqaluit Update
November 20, 2020 – Iqaluit, Nunavut

 

The City of Iqaluit continues to work closely with the Government of Nunavut’s Department of Health to monitor and respond as needed to the COVID-19 situation.

Recreation Facilities

The Elders Qammaq, Makkuttukkuvik Youth Centre, AWG and curling rink are closed until further notice. All city-run playgrounds are closed to the public.
